Suppose you construct lines L ,M and N so that L ⊥ N and M||N which os the following is true

If one line is perpendicular to one of 2 parallel lines, then it must be perpendicular to the other line
Since
[tex]L\perp N[/tex]Since
[tex]M\text{ / / N}[/tex]Then L must be perpendicular to M
The answer is
[tex]L\perp M[/tex]The answer is option 2
